Hong Kong to tender residential site at Choi Hing Road, Kowloon
The site is expected to provide 570 flats once rezoned.
Hong Kong will tender a residential site at Choi Hing Road in Jordan Valley, Kowloon this quarter under its land sale programme to boost housing supply, according to an announcement on 9 October 2025.
Located near New Clear Water Bay Road, the site is expected to provide about 570 flats once rezoned for residential use. The rezoning process is expected to conclude within the quarter.
The government will require the developer to allocate part of the floor area for social welfare facilities.
The project will benefit from relaxed gross floor area exemptions for car parks, allowing no more than two storeys of above-ground parking to qualify for full exemption without underground construction. The measure is intended to lower building costs and shorten project timelines, the government said.
Including MTR Corporation’s Tuen Mun Area 16 project, residential land supply this quarter is expected to support around 6,420 flats.
Cumulative supply for the first three quarters of the financial year will reach about 12,430 units, representing 94%of the annual target, said Bernadette Linn, Secretary for Development.
